Best Overall: Make Up For Ever HD Skin All-In-One Face Palette

Why it’s worth it: Make Up For Ever’s HD Skin All-In-One Face Palette snagged a 2024 Best of Beauty Award for its versatility: Each creamy pan delivers a buildable, dimensional flush alongside adaptable contour, highlight, and concealer shades. You can apply the multi-use formulas with your fingertips or load up your favorite brush with any of the 12 options—two of which are intended as rouge, but the real fun is mixing, matching, and blurring the definition of blush itself.

Tester feedback: “These cream palettes aren’t just blush, but they have plenty of blush shade options,” says content director Kara McGrath. “I love how easily buildable they are: The first swipe of blush is super sheer, but you can layer it up for a more natural flush. Since there are 12 shades in each palette, they’re great for travel, too.”

Finish: dewy | Formula: cream | Shades: 12

Best Light-Diffusing: Hourglass Ambient Lighting Edit Unlocked Evil Eye Face Palette

Why it’s worth it: Hourglass’s Ambient Lighting Edit Unlocked Evil Eye Face Palette features five light-diffusing pans of blush, bronzer, highlighter, and finishing powder for a radiant, inside-out glow. Build out your look with the Pink Fusion blush, add subtle matte contour with Natural Bronze, and round it out with the shimmery Rose Gold Strobe highlight. For best results, pair it with the Hourglass Ambient Lighting Edit Brush, which has dual sides to keep product application neat and seamless.

Best Dewy Finish: RMS Beauty Signature Set in Pop Collection

Why it’s worth it: There’s versatility, and then there’s the versatility of the RMS Beauty Signature Set in Pop Collection. Not only does this palette include two bright balm blushes (that double as lightweight lippies), but it’s complimented by a creamy highlighter and bronzer and an untinted, vanilla lip balm for an all-in-one we can always count on. This palette doesn’t skimp on the skin care, either. You’ll find nourishing ingredients you already know and love, like jojoba and coconut oils, for soothing hydration that supports your glow.
